MS SQL Server SSIS with .Net

Q1 Technologies, Inc

Addison, TX

JOB DETAILS
SKILLS
Agile Programming Methodologies, Application Programming Interface (API), Architectural Services, Auditing, Authentication, Best Practices, Caching, Communication Skills, Continuous Deployment/Delivery, Continuous Integration, Data Quality, Data Recovery, Database Extract Transform and Load (ETL), Database Optimization, Database Technology, Error Handling, Integration Testing, Metrics, Microservices, Microsoft .NET, Microsoft ASP.NET (Active Server Page), Microsoft SQL Server, Microsoft Transact-SQL (T-SQL), OAuth, Operations Management, Pagination, Performance Tuning/Optimization, Problem Solving Skills, Production Support, Quality Assurance, REST (Representational State Transfer), Reporting Dashboards, SQL (Structured Query Language), SQL Server Integration Services (SSIS), Scrum Project Management and Software Development, Static Analysis, Stored Procedures, Test Automation, Unit Test, User Interface Design, User Interface/Experience (UI/UX)
LOCATION
Addison, TX
POSTED
30+ days ago
Job Description
Must Have Technical/Functional Skills
Primary Skill: MS SQL Server, SSIS / ETL, .NET / ASP.NET Core, C# / Web API, Angular 18/19
Experience: Minimum 10 years

Roles & Responsibilities
• Design and optimize SQL Server databases—schemas, indexes, views, stored procedures, and performant T SQL.
• Develop and maintain SSIS ETL pipelines for data ingestion, transformation, validation, scheduling, and error handling.
• Implement secure, scalable REST APIs with ASP.NET Core, including authentication/authorization (JWT/OAuth) and input validation.
• Build modern Angular (18/19) UIs using standalone components, reactive forms, interceptors, guards, and RxJS/Signals for state.
• Integrate Angular front-end with .NET back-end, ensuring secure token handling, robust error management, and efficient data flows.
• Apply architectural best practices—SOLID, clean architecture, layered/microservices patterns, and reusable UI/component design.
• Ensure data integrity and governance with auditing, logging, role-based access, and compliance for sensitive data (PII).
• Optimize performance end-to-end—query tuning, ETL throughput, API latency, caching, pagination, and UI rendering.
• Automate builds, tests, and deployments (CI/CD) using pipelines, unit/integration testing (xUnit/Jest/Cypress), and static analysis.
• Monitor and observe systems with logging, tracing, metrics, dashboards, alerts, and RCA for incidents across SQL/ETL/API/UI.
• Manage jobs and operations—SQL Server Agent tasks, maintenance plans, backups/restores, environment migrations (DEV/QA/PROD).
• Collaborate in Agile/Scrum—participate in ceremonies, refine requirements, estimate work, and maintain delivery commitments.
• Document solutions thoroughly—ER diagrams, API specs, SSIS runbooks, deployment guides, and operational playbooks.
• Ensure security-by-design—OWASP practices, parameterized queries, secret management, API versioning, and least-privilege access.
• Provide production support—triage issues, implement fixes, prevent regressions, and communicate clearly with stakeholders.

About the Company

Q

Q1 Technologies, Inc

Q1 consists of experienced and recognized experts providing the capability to respond to market demand in order to provide professional services for our clients including Enterprise software implementations, application integration and technical / functional support.

Q1 has steadily grown into a Quality IT services and solutions organization with the average experience of our team being over 10 years. We have continuously met or exceeded client expectations by delivering professional services and project implementations on time and under budget to help clients truly recognize return on investment.

COMPANY SIZE
500 to 999 employees
INDUSTRY
Computer/IT Services
FOUNDED
1990
WEBSITE
http://q1tech.com/